Financial freedom is not about getting rich quickly. It is about building a system of habits, margins, and investments that compound quietly over decades.

1. Establish your baseline

Before you can grow, you need clarity. Track every dollar for 30 days. Not to shame yourself — to see yourself.

2. Create margin

Cut ruthlessly in three categories: subscriptions you forgot about, food delivery, and lifestyle creep. Redirect that margin into a high-yield savings account.

3. Build the vault

A one-month emergency fund is peace. Three months is power. Six is freedom.

4. Invest with patience

Index funds, real estate, and your own skills are the three most reliable engines. Ignore anyone selling you a fourth.

5. Steward, don't hoard

Wealth without purpose corrodes. Give generously, invest thoughtfully, and let your money serve people — including your future self.
